An XLR Female to XLR Female cable coupler (also called an XLR gender changer or XLR barrel adapter) serves a few practical purposes in audio setups. Here are its key benefits:

  1. Extending Cable Length

The most common use is to connect two XLR male-ended cables together, effectively creating one longer cable.

Example: If you have two 25-foot mic cables, using a female-to-female coupler turns them into a single 50-foot run.

This helps avoid buying a single long cable when shorter ones can be combined as needed.

  1. Gender Conversion

Converts the male end of an XLR cable into a female connector.

Useful when a device or setup requires a specific connector type that your existing cables don’t match.

  1. Flexibility in Signal Routing

Handy in complex setups (like studios, live sound rigs, or patch bays) where you may need to temporarily reconfigure connections without rewiring or repatching.

Provides a quick fix for mismatched genders in an audio chain.

  1. Maintaining Balanced Audio

XLR couplers preserve balanced signal integrity, which helps reduce noise and interference over long cable runs.

This makes them preferable to makeshift adapters or unbalanced connectors.

  1. Durability and Convenience

Typically made of metal housings and secure locking connectors, ensuring a reliable, low-noise connection even in demanding live or studio environments.

Compact and portable - easy to keep in a gig bag or toolbox as a backup solution.

What makes a “best” coupler

Here are the features that distinguish a good XLR F-to-F coupler from a “just-okay” one:

Feature - Solid construction (metal body, good strain relief) Why it matters: To endure plugging/unplugging, pulling, bending; reduces mechanical failure.

Feature - Secure locking / accurate latch mechanism Why it matters: Ensures the male XLR fits firmly; loose latches can cause noisy connections or disconnects.

Feature - Good contact plating (nickel, gold, etc.) Why it matters: Better conductivity, resistance to corrosion. Gold is pricier but helps in harsh conditions.

Feature - Low electrical impedance / good wiring “pin-to-pin” Why it matters: Ensures minimal signal degradation or loss, especially over multiple connections.
